In his third solo show at Ronald Feldman Fine Arts, Cameron Hayes will exhibit new paintings and stuffed sculptures. Among the elaborate large-scale narrative paintings on view are, The Russians knew perfectly well that the happiness of the African animals was that they had such low expectations – before the pets were introduced and By the end Pavlov saw everything as just saliva and bells.
